What are the guidelines for corporate connections?

A minimum of five connections is required to be booked in the name of the corporate along with requisite documents. No security deposit is required for corporate connections. For details contact corporate manager on 9415000455

I am having problem in sending or receiving SMS.

"In case of problem in sending SMS (first time), please check that correct service centre number (+919417099997) is selected. For subsequent problem, check your memory box (Incoming or Outgoing). If problem still continues, dial help-line 9415024365 to arrange needful action"

Is there any initial deposit for SMS? What is rental for SMS?

"There is no initial deposit for SMS. It is available with every connection. There is no rental charge for SMS, however, usage charges are to be paid."

What are the charges for SMS in various plans? What is the SMS charge while subscriber is on roaming?


"The SMS (Maximum 160 characters) are charged @ Re.0.40 per message within same license area. Re.0.80 per message is charged for sending SMS to outside SA or while on roaming. All incoming messages (SMS) are free"

What is pulse system in BSNL Mobile Postpaid? Is it same for incoming and outgoing calls?

"It is the minimum time period for which call will be charged.
The BSNL Mobile Postpaid outgoing call pulse is @15 seconds interval.
The BSNL Mobile Postpaid incoming call pulse is@ 60 seconds interval.
For example, in Plan-325 call charges when cell-to-cell calls are made within the same circle, the call charges will be Rs. 1.40/- per minutes. Under this situation, the call charges are Re. 0.35 per fifteen seconds, so, if, call duration is 25 second then call charges will Re.0.70/-."

What amount will be charged when subscriber –A at Sitapur of UP (E) Cellular Circle Lucknow makes a call to subscriber-B at Balia of UP (E) Cellular Circle?
Subscriber – A will have to pay the local call charges only because both places are in the same license service area whereas subscriber –B has to pay nothing.

What amount will be charged when subscriber –A of UP (E) Cellular Circle Lucknow while roaming at New Delhi making a call to subscriber -B of UP (East) Cellular Circle roaming at (a) New Delhi (b) Mumbai?
Subscriber –A will have to pay the STD charges from Delhi to Lucknow in both cases whereas subscriber-B (while receiving the call) will have to pay the STD charge from Lucknow to New Delhi for case (a) and Lucknow to Mumbai for case (b) above.

What amount will be charged when subscriber –A of UP (E) Cellular Circle Lucknow while roaming at New Delhi making a call to subscriber - B of UP (West) Cellular Circle roaming at (a) Varanasi (b) Mumbai?
Subscriber –A will have to pay the STD charges from Delhi to Agra in both cases whereas subscriber-B (while receiving the call) will have to pay the STD charge from Agra to Lucknow for case (a) and Agra to Mumbai for case (b) above.
